技术文摘
15 个必知的 JavaScript 重要数组方法
15 个必知的 JavaScript 重要数组方法
在 JavaScript 编程中,数组是一种非常常见且强大的数据结构。掌握一些重要的数组方法可以极大地提高编程效率和代码质量。以下是 15 个必知的 JavaScript 数组方法:
push():在数组末尾添加一个或多个元素,并返回新的数组长度。pop():删除数组的最后一个元素,并返回被删除的元素。shift():删除数组的第一个元素,并返回被删除的元素。unshift():在数组开头添加一个或多个元素,并返回新的数组长度。slice():返回一个新的数组,包含从指定起始位置到结束位置(不包括结束位置)的元素。splice():可以用于删除、替换或添加数组中的元素。concat():连接两个或多个数组,并返回一个新的数组。join():将数组的所有元素连接成一个字符串。map():创建一个新数组,其结果是对原数组中的每个元素调用提供的函数后的返回值。filter():创建一个新数组,其中包含通过提供的函数实现的测试的所有元素。reduce():对数组中的每个元素执行一个提供的 reducer 函数,将其结果汇总为单个返回值。some():检查数组中是否至少有一个元素通过提供的函数实现的测试。every():检查数组中所有元素是否都通过提供的函数实现的测试。find():返回数组中满足提供的测试函数的第一个元素的值。findIndex():返回数组中满足提供的测试函数的第一个元素的索引。
熟练掌握这些数组方法,能够让您在处理数据时更加得心应手。例如,使用 map() 方法可以轻松地对数组中的每个元素进行转换,而 filter() 方法能帮助筛选出符合特定条件的元素。reduce() 方法则适用于对数组元素进行复杂的计算和汇总操作。
在实际编程中,根据具体的需求选择合适的数组方法,可以使代码更加简洁、高效和易于维护。不断地实践和运用这些方法,您将能够更加熟练地驾驭 JavaScript 中的数组操作,提升自己的编程能力。
TAGS: JavaScript 编程 JavaScript 数组方法 重要 JavaScript 特性 JavaScript 数组技巧
- CSS边框与轮廓的区别解析
- Vue开发必知:熟练运用v-if、v-show、v-else、v-else-if达成条件渲染
- Vue 条件渲染大揭秘:巧用 v-if、v-show、v-else、v-else-if 打造高效动态界面
- 掌握Vue中v-on指令处理鼠标移入移出事件的方法
- 怎样检查对象的构造函数是否为 JavaScript 对象
- Vue Router重定向功能性能优化实用技巧
- Vue项目中使用Router实现重定向功能的方法
- Vue条件渲染高级技巧:巧用v-if、v-show、v-else、v-else-if完成复杂逻辑判断
- Vue中v-on指令详解:处理键盘按下与释放事件的方法
- Vue Router实现基于角色的重定向控制
- Vue Router中多种不同类型重定向规则的配置方法
- Vue进阶:深挖v-if、v-show、v-else、v-else-if的实现原理
- 用Vue的v-on指令处理键盘组合键事件
- Vue Router Lazy-Loading路由技术提升页面性能的关键方法
- 始终把握最新技术趋势:Vue Router Lazy-Loading路由提升页面性能